What does a plumbing inspection involve for my septic system in Jackson?
A thorough plumbing inspection for your septic system involves checking all components, from the tank to the drain field. Our licensed technicians will assess the tank's sludge and scum levels, inspect inlet and outlet baffles, and look for signs of leaks or damage. In Jackson County, we also recommend reviewing your county-maintained septic system map during the inspection to identify the exact layout and location of your drain field. This comprehensive check helps us catch minor issues before they lead to major system failures, like sewer backups or drain field clogs.
How can regular septic pumping prevent sewer backups in my Jackson home?
Regular septic pumping is the most effective way to prevent sewer backups, a common issue in the area. When a tank isn't pumped, solid waste (sludge) builds up and can be forced out into the drain field. This clogs the soil, causing wastewater to back up into your home's plumbing. We recommend pumping every 3-5 years, but frequency depends on household size and usage. Our decades of service in Jackson County mean we understand local soil conditions and system designs, allowing us to provide a pumping schedule that keeps your system flowing properly and prevents disruptive, unsanitary backups.
